Dr. Michael Eisemann is a "triple" board certified plastic surgeon serving Houston, Texas and its surrounding cities and counties for over 20 years. He currently operates at the Eisemann Cosmetic DaySurgery Center and also at Methodist Hospital, St. Lukes Hospital and other area hospitals.

Education:
Following his undergraduate studies at Colgate University, Dr. Eisemann attended the Thomas Jefferson Medical College in Philadelphia. From there he went on to complete a general surgery residency at Yale and later received special residency training in Otolaryngology and Head and Neck surgery at the Johns Hopkins University.

Residency:
Johns Hopkins University. He also completed an additional residency in Plastic and Reconstructive surgery at the Baylor College of Medicine.
